Analysis
Europe & Central Asia recorded 1.19 units per person for air transport, passengers carried, per capita in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 18.8% on the previous year and up 29.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, air transport, passengers carried, per capita in Europe & Central Asia peaked at 1.28 units per person in 2019 and was at its lowest, 0.3399 units per person, in 1993.
Europe & Central Asia ranks 5th of 44 groups on this measure, in the top 10%.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 33 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Air transport, passengers carried div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Air transport, passengers carried 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Air transport, passengers carried Civil Aviation Statistics of the World, International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O)
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
